/// Returns true when the rendered test body contains a word-boundary reference to `symbol`.
/// Used to decide whether a `use ...::Symbol;` import is needed; emitting it unconditionally
/// trips `-D unused_imports` for fixtures whose bodies never reference the symbol.
pub(super) fn body_references_symbol(body: &str, symbol: &str) -> bool {
    let bytes = body.as_bytes();
    let sym = symbol.as_bytes();
    let n = bytes.len();
    let m = sym.len();
    if m == 0 || m > n {
        return false;
    }
    let is_word = |b: u8| b.is_ascii_alphanumeric() || b == b'_';
    let mut i = 0;
    while i + m <= n {
        if bytes[i..i + m] == *sym {
            let before_ok = i == 0 || !is_word(bytes[i - 1]);
            let after_ok = i + m == n || !is_word(bytes[i + m]);
            if before_ok && after_ok {
                return true;
            }
        }
        i += 1;
    }
    false
}
